Jonathan Dickinson State
Park is a Florida State Park and historic site located in
Martin County, Florida, between Hobe Sound and Tequesta. The park
includes a variety of natural communities, such as sand pine scrub,
pine flatwoods, mangroves, and river swamps. The Loxahatchee River,
which was named a National Wild and Scenic River in 1985 (the first
in Florida), runs through the park. Cacheapalooza 6 will be a
